First pass at readme - just listing general requirements

  • All plays are designed to be run from the user ansible
  • All plays assume remote machine has been configured to be managed by ansible
    • there is a play to configure a machine for this: init_0_config_ansible.yaml
  • For ansible to configure machines without having to enter rsa passphrase or the root password the following must happen:
    • Load the ansible private rsa key into an ssh agent:
      1. ssh-agent bash
      2. ssh-add <location of private rsa key
        • ex: ssh-add user_vars/user_keys/ansible/ansible/ansible
    • Ansible needs to know root password for privledge escalation, so each time you run a play you can do the following, which prevents storing the root password in plain text.
      • --ask-pass <root password>
        • ex: ansible-playbook -i hosts/test-inventory full_system_configuration.yaml --ask-pass
  • This playbook is configured to be run from the directory this readme is located.

useful commands:

  • ansible -i hosts/test-inventory all -m debug -a 'var=group_names'
    • Prints each host and what groups they are in
  • ansible -i hosts/test-inventory localhost -m debug -a 'var=groups'
    • Prints members of each group
  • append the following to plays to see what will be run
    • --list-tasks
    • --list-hosts
